@charset "UTF-8";.DetailBox__girlSchedule{display:flex;justify-content:flex-start}@media screen and (max-width:960px){.DetailBox__girlSchedule{overflow-x:scroll;width:calc(100% + 2.66667vw)}}.DetailBox__girlSchedule__item{width:14.28571%;display:flex;flex-direction:column}@media screen and (max-width:960px){.DetailBox__girlSchedule__item{width:28vw;min-width:28vw;box-shadow:0 3px 10px rgba(0,0,0,.3);border-radius:10px;margin:2.6666666667vw 1.3333333333vw}}.DetailBox__girlSchedule__item:first-child .DetailBox__girlSchedule__head{border-left:1px solid #fd799e}@media screen and (max-width:960px){.DetailBox__girlSchedule__item:first-child .DetailBox__girlSchedule__head{border:none}}.DetailBox__girlSchedule__item:first-child .DetailBox__girlSchedule__desc{border-left:1px solid #fd799e}@media screen and (max-width:960px){.DetailBox__girlSchedule__item:first-child .DetailBox__girlSchedule__desc{border:none}}.DetailBox__girlSchedule__head{border:1px solid #fd799e;border-left:none;width:100%;background-color:#ffffb2;height:60px;display:flex;justify-content:center;align-items:center;font-size:1.5em;font-weight:700}@media screen and (max-width:960px){.DetailBox__girlSchedule__head{height:16vw;font-size:3.7333333333vw;color:#fff;background:#474747;border-top-left-radius:10px;border-top-right-radius:10px;border:none}}@media screen and (max-width:960px){.DetailBox__girlSchedule__head br{display:none}}.DetailBox__girlSchedule__head.sunday{color:#fd79a8}@media screen and (max-width:960px){.DetailBox__girlSchedule__head.sunday{color:#fff;background:#fd79a8}}.DetailBox__girlSchedule__head.saturday{color:#0984e3}@media screen and (max-width:960px){.DetailBox__girlSchedule__head.saturday{background:#0984e3;color:#fff}}.DetailBox__girlSchedule__desc{width:100%;border:1px solid #fd799e;border-top:none;border-left:none;height:60px;display:flex;justify-content:center;align-items:center;font-size:1.4em}@media screen and (max-width:960px){.DetailBox__girlSchedule__desc{border:none;height:16vw;font-size:3.7333333333vw}}.DetailBox__shame-top{display:flex;justify-content:space-between;flex-wrap:wrap;margin-bottom:20px}@media screen and (max-width:960px){.DetailBox__shame-top{overflow-x:scroll;overflow-y:hidden;margin:0 0 5.3333333333vw -4vw;padding:0 4vw;flex-wrap:nowrap;justify-content:flex-start}}.DetailBox__shame-top:before{content:"";width:185px;order:1}@media screen and (max-width:960px){.DetailBox__shame-top:before{display:none}}.DetailBox__shame-top:after{content:"";width:185px}@media screen and (max-width:960px){.DetailBox__shame-top:after{display:none}}.DetailBox__shame-top__box{width:185px}@media screen and (max-width:960px){.DetailBox__shame-top__box{width:49.3333333333vw;min-width:49.3333333333vw;margin-right:2.6666666667vw}}.DetailBox__shame-top__box__img{width:100%;height:185px;margin-bottom:10px}@media screen and (max-width:960px){.DetailBox__shame-top__box__img{height:49.3333333333vw;margin-bottom:2.6666666667vw}}.DetailBox__shame-top__box__img__img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.DetailBox__shame-top__box__text__description__title{font-weight:700;font-size:1.6em;color:#e84393;text-overflow:ellipsis;white-space:nowrap;overflow:hidden}@media screen and (max-width:960px){.DetailBox__shame-top__box__text__description__title{font-size:4.2666666667vw}}.DetailBox__shame-top__box__text__description__text{font-size:1.4em;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den}@media screen and (max-width:960px){.DetailBox__shame-top__box__text__description__text{font-size:3.7333333333vw}}.DetailBox__shopvoice__notFound{margin-bottom:20px;font-size:1.6em;text-align:center}@media screen and (max-width:960px){.DetailBox__shopvoice__notFound{margin-bottom:2.6666666667vw;font-size:3.7333333333vw}}@media screen and (max-width:960px){.DetailBox__shopvoice__girl{display:flex;justify-content:flex-start;flex-wrap:nowrap;overflow-x:scroll;overflow-y:hidden;width:calc(100% + 5.33333vw);margin-left:-2.6666666667vw;padding-left:2.6666666667vw}}.DetailBox__shopvoice__girl .DetailBox__shopvoice{padding:20px;border:1px solid #fd79a8;margin-bottom:20px}@media screen and (max-width:960px){.DetailBox__shopvoice__girl .DetailBox__shopvoice{padding:2.6666666667vw;min-width:66.6666666667vw;margin-right:2.6666666667vw;box-shadow:2px 2px 9px grey}}.DetailBox__shopvoice__girl .DetailBox__shopvoice__text__wrap__text{width:100%}.DetailBox__shopvoice__girl .DetailBox__shopvoice__text__meta{display:block}.DetailBox__shopvoice__girl .DetailBox__shopvoice__text__meta__name{display:flex;font-size:1.4em}@media screen and (max-width:960px){.DetailBox__shopvoice__girl .DetailBox__shopvoice__text__meta__name{display:block;font-size:3.2vw}}.DetailBox__shopvoice__girl .DetailBox__shopvoice__text__meta__name__title{color:#000}.DetailBox__shopvoice__girl .DetailBox__shopvoice__text__meta__name__user{color:#e84393;margin-left:3px}@media screen and (max-width:960px){.DetailBox__shopvoice__girl .DetailBox__shopvoice__text__meta__name__user{margin-left:.8vw}}.DetailBox__shopvoice__evaluate{border:3px solid #fd8;background-color:#ffc;padding:15px 20px;margin-bottom:10px}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ate{padding:3.2vw 1.3333333333vw;margin-bottom:1.3333333333vw}}.DetailBox__shopvoice__evaluate__lady{display:flex;justify-content:flex-start;margin-bottom:5px;align-items:center}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__lady{width:100%;flex-wrap:wrap;margin-bottom:1.3333333333vw}}.DetailBox__shopvoice__evaluate__lady__th{font-size:1.8em;width:80px;font-weight:700}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__lady__th{width:13.3333333333vw;font-size:3.4666666667vw}}.DetailBox__shopvoice__evaluate__lady__td{width:115px;color:#e9c456;font-size:2em;--star-background:#e9c456;--percent:calc(var(--rating)/5*100%);--star-color:#fff}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__lady__td{width:30.6666666667vw;font-size:4vw;letter-spacing:.2666666667vw}}.DetailBox__shopvoice__evaluate__lady__td:before{content:"\2605\2605\2605\2605\2605";background:linear-gradient(90deg,var(--star-background) var(--percent),var(--star-color) var(--percent));-webkit-background-clip:text;-webkit-text-fill-color:transparent;text-stroke:.4px #848484;-webkit-text-stroke:.4px #848484}.DetailBox__shopvoice__evaluate__lady__num{font-size:2.4em;font-weight:700;color:#fe0000;line-height:1}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__lady__num{font-size:4.8vw}}.DetailBox__shopvoice__evaluate__lady__text{line-height:1;font-size:1.2em;margin-left:20px}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__lady__text{width:100%;margin:2.6666666667vw 0 0;font-size:2.4vw}}.DetailBox__shopvoice__evaluate__lady-detail{display:flex;justify-content:space-around;flex-wrap:wrap;margin-top:10px;margin-bottom:10px}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__lady-detail{margin-top:2.6666666667vw;margin-bottom:2.6666666667vw}}.DetailBox__shopvoice__evaluate__lady-detail__box{display:flex;justify-content:flex-start;margin-bottom:10px;align-items:center;width:50%}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__lady-detail__box{flex-wrap:wrap;margin-bottom:2.6666666667vw}}.DetailBox__shopvoice__evaluate__lady-detail__box__th{font-size:1.4em;font-weight:700}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__lady-detail__box__th{font-size:3.2vw;width:100%}}.DetailBox__shopvoice__evaluate__lady-detail__box__td{color:#e9c456;text-shadow:0 0 1px #000;font-size:1.4em;letter-spacing:.1em}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__lady-detail__box__td{font-size:4vw;letter-spacing:.2666666667vw}}.DetailBox__shopvoice__evaluate__shop{display:flex;justify-content:flex-start;align-items:center}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__shop{flex-wrap:wrap;justify-content:flex-start;margin-top:2.6666666667vw}}.DetailBox__shopvoice__evaluate__shop__th{font-size:1.8em;width:80px;font-weight:700}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__shop__th{font-size:3.4666666667vw;width:13.3333333333vw}}.DetailBox__shopvoice__evaluate__shop__td{font-weight:700;font-size:2em;width:115px;color:#e84393;--star-background:#e84393;--percent:calc(var(--rating)/5*100%);--star-color:#fff}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__shop__td{width:30.6666666667vw;font-size:4vw}}.DetailBox__shopvoice__evaluate__shop__td:before{content:"\2605\2605\2605\2605\2605";background:linear-gradient(90deg,var(--star-background) var(--percent),var(--star-color) var(--percent));-webkit-background-clip:text;-webkit-text-fill-color:transparent;text-stroke:.4px #848484;-webkit-text-stroke:.4px #848484}.DetailBox__shopvoice__evaluate__shop__num{font-size:2.4em;font-weight:700;color:#fe0000;line-height:1}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__shop__num{font-size:4.8vw}}.DetailBox__shopvoice__evaluate__shop__text{line-height:1;font-size:1.2em;margin-left:20px}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__shop__text{width:100%;margin:2.6666666667vw 0 0;font-size:2.4vw}}.DetailBox__shopvoice__evaluate__shop-detail{display:flex;justify-content:space-around;flex-wrap:wrap;margin-top:10px}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__shop-detail{margin-top:2.6666666667vw}}.DetailBox__shopvoice__evaluate__shop-detail__box{display:flex;justify-content:flex-start;margin-bottom:10px;align-items:center;width:50%}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__shop-detail__box{flex-wrap:wrap;margin-bottom:2.6666666667vw}}.DetailBox__shopvoice__evaluate__shop-detail__box__th{font-size:1.4em;font-weight:700}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__shop-detail__box__th{font-size:3.2vw;width:100%}}.DetailBox__shopvoice__evaluate__shop-detail__box__td{color:#e84393;text-shadow:0 0 1px #000;font-size:1.4em;letter-spacing:.1em}@media screen and (max-width:960px){.DetailBox__shopvoice__evaluate__shop-detail__box__td{font-size:4vw;letter-spacing:.2666666667vw}}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text{width:100%}}.DetailBox__shopvoice__wrap__text__meta{display:flex;justify-content:flex-start;align-items:center;margin-bottom:5px}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__meta{display:block;margin-bottom:1.3333333333vw}}.DetailBox__shopvoice__wrap__text__meta__tag{min-width:160px;height:24px;border-radius:12px;display:flex;justify-content:center;align-items:center;color:#f90;border:1px solid #f90;font-weight:700;font-size:1.2em;margin-right:15px}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__meta__tag{min-width:42.6666666667vw;height:6.4vw;margin-right:4vw;font-size:3.2vw;border-radius:3.2vw}}.DetailBox__shopvoice__wrap__text__meta__tag--wrap{height:24px}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__meta__tag--wrap{height:6.4vw}}.DetailBox__shopvoice__wrap__text__meta__name{font-size:1.1em;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;color:#e84393}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__meta__name{font-size:2.6666666667vw}}.DetailBox__shopvoice__wrap__text__data{margin-bottom:10px}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__data{display:none}}.DetailBox__shopvoice__wrap__text__data__name{font-size:1.6em;font-weight:700;display:block;text-overflow:ellipsis;white-space:nowrap;overflow:hidden}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__data__name{font-size:4.2666666667vw}}.DetailBox__shopvoice__wrap__text__data__data{font-size:1em}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__data__data{font-size:2.6666666667vw}}.DetailBox__shopvoice__wrap__text__title{font-size:2em;color:#e84393;font-weight:700;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;margin-bottom:5px}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__title{margin-bottom:1.3333333333vw;font-size:4.8vw}}.DetailBox__shopvoice__wrap__text__wrap__text{font-size:1.4em;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;overflow:hidden;margin-bottom:10px}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__wrap__text{font-size:3.2vw;margin-bottom:.8vw}}.DetailBox__shopvoice__wrap__text__wrap__bottom{display:flex;justify-content:space-between}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__wrap__bottom{flex-direction:column}}.DetailBox__shopvoice__wrap__text__wrap__bottom__time{font-size:1.4em}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__wrap__bottom__time{order:2;font-size:3.2vw;margin-top:2.6666666667vw}}.DetailBox__shopvoice__wrap__text__wrap__bottom__more{font-size:1.4em;color:#e84393;margin-right:3px}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__wrap__bottom__more{order:1;margin-right:.8vw;font-size:3.2vw;text-align:right}}.DetailBox__shopvoice__wrap__text__wrap__bottom__more:after{font-family:Font Awesome\ 6 Free;font-weight:900;content:"\F101";padding-left:5px}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__wrap__bottom__more:after{padding-left:1.3333333333vw}}.DetailBox__shopvoice__wrap__text__wrap__img{display:none}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__wrap__img{display:block;width:37.3333333333vw}}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__wrap__img__img{width:100%}}.DetailBox__shopvoice__wrap__text__wrap__img__data__name{font-size:1.3em;font-weight:700}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__wrap__img__data__name{font-size:3.4666666667vw}}.DetailBox__shopvoice__wrap__text__wrap__img__data__data{display:block;font-size:.9em}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__wrap__img__data__data{font-size:2.4vw}}.DetailBox__shopvoice__wrap__text__box{display:flex;justify-content:space-between}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__box{display:block}}.DetailBox__shopvoice__wrap__text__box__text__more{color:#e84393;font-size:13px;position:relative}@media screen and (max-width:960px){.DetailBox__shopvoice__wrap__text__box__text__more{display:block;margin-top:2.6666666667vw;font-size:3.4666666667vw;bottom:auto;text-align:left;right:auto}}.DetailBox__shopvoice__img{width:140px}@media screen and (max-width:960px){.DetailBox__shopvoice__img{display:none}}.DetailBox__shopvoice__img__wrap{position:relative;display:block;margin-bottom:5px}@media screen and (max-width:960px){.DetailBox__shopvoice__img__wrap{margin-bottom:1.3333333333vw}}.DetailBox__shopvoice__img__wrap:before{display:block;content:"";padding-top:133%}.DetailBox__shopvoice__img__wrap__img{position:absolute;top:0;left:0;width:100%;height:100%;-o-object-fit:cover;object-fit:cover}